Nurse arrested for stealing prison inmate's medication, officials say

EVANSVILLE, Ind. (WFIE/Gray News) – A nurse was arrested after stealing medication from a prison inmate, officials said.

On August 7, authorities began investigating Tracy Davis, a third-party employee who works at the Vanderburgh County Jail.

According to authorities, prison staff believed she may have been impaired because she appeared disoriented and confused.

According to authorities, surveillance camera footage shows Davis tampering with the Suboxone pills and moving them from their usual storage location to a location out of view of the camera.

Suboxone is a prescription opioid used to treat opioid addiction.

Investigators found several errors in Davis' entries in the prison drug registry.

On August 8, she returned to work at the prison and was questioned by detectives, who said she admitted to taking Suboxone.

Davis was arrested and booked into the Vanderburgh County Jail on charges of theft and drug possession.
